Mount Saint Vincent University

Mount Saint Vincent University (MSVU) is a public liberal arts university located in Halifax. Established in 1873, it was originally founded by the Sisters of Charity and played a pioneering role in providing higher education to women in Canada.

Today, MSVU is a primarily undergraduate university with a strong focus on teaching quality, small class sizes, and community-based learning. It has around 3,700+ students and offers programs in arts, science, education, and professional studies.

📚 Key Highlights

  • Offers 40+ undergraduate degrees and several graduate programs
  • Known for small class sizes (avg. ~23 students)
  • Strong emphasis on co-op, internships, and practical learning
  • Students from 70+ countries
  • Houses research centres in areas like gender studies, food security, and education
